3 Introduction Congratulations on your purchase of the new SkyWave DX150 RF Amplifier PCB. This PCB is a result of the highest quality engineering to provide excellent performance and reliability. Listed below are some of the key features: +13.8VDC Operation All Mode (AM, FM, SSB) 10-Meter Amateur Band Coverage MOSFET (FQP13N10) Push-Pull Configuration Low Current Requirement Can Plug into Most Vehicle Cigarette Lighter Receptacles Class-AB Bias High Output Power / Low Harmonic Content Carrier Operated or Manual* Transmit / Receive Switching Continuous Reverse Voltage Protection without Damage to Amplifier or Fuse Thermal Shutdown Fuse Protected Selectable SSB Delay Power and Transmit Indicators Low Stand-By Power Consumption Teflon Insulated Wire Premium Quality FR-4 Grade Printed Circuit Board w/ Solder Mask & Silk Screen High Reliability Design We have developed a logical step-by-step procedure that we hope will make your assembling experience efficient & pleasurable * Contact Telstar Electronics for details on using this feature. 6 Before You Start This document assumes a basic understanding of electronics, soldering, and operation of hand tools. In addition to basic hand tools, the following items will be required for proper assembly. PCB Assembly: Soldering Iron Electronic Solder 7/64 Drill Bit (Alignment of SPACER1, SPACER2, SPACER3, SPACER4) 1/4 Drill Bit (Lead Forming of U1, Q1, Q4, Q5) Needle Nose Pliers Diagonal Cutting Pliers Wire Stripper PCB Assembly to Heat Sink: Heat Sink (See Page 39 for Requirements) Power Drill #4-40 Tap (Mounting Holes in Heat Sink) #42 Drill Bit (Mounting Holes in Heat Sink) Masking Tape Transfer Punch Bias Adjustment: 13.8VDC Power Supply (1 Ampere Minimum) Ammeter (Capable of Measuring 200mA) Several Jumper Wires w/ Alligator Clips Please take a few minutes before you begin assembling to review the entire assembly & adjustment procedure. A few things to remember during the assembly: Several components in this design are sensitive to static electricity. Precautions should be taken to avoid static buildup during assembly by using a grounded workstation mat and wrist band. References are made to the top and bottom side of the PCB. The top side contains the printed reference designators and component outlines. If at any time, you re unsure how to perform an assembly step or have a question, us for assistance at telstar.electronics@comcast.net 35W-65W recommended. Temperature controlled soldering equipment is always preferred. Solder recommendation is Kester 331. This solder has a flux that can be washed off with warm tap-water. Page 6 of 46

9 Step #2 - Transformer (T1, T2) T1 IMPORTANT - TRANSFORMERS ARE POLARIZED AND MUST BE INSTALLED IN THE PROPER ORIENTATION. Position T1 on the PCB noting the proper transformer polarity. (Figure 3) Solder all three pads on T1 for proper attachment to PCB. Strip the insulation from one end of the 6 AWG#20 wire. Solder the stripped end to the START pad. (Figure 3) Wind the unsoldered end of the wire three complete turns through the tubes of the transformer in a loop type fashion. (Figure 4 and Figure 5) Cut and strip the wire, making it just long enough to reach to the FINISH pad. (Figure 3) Solder the wire to FINISH pad. (Figure 3) START T1 FINISH Figure 3 Page 9 of 46

39 PCB Mounting to Heat Sink IMPORTANT - NOW THAT THE AMPLIFIER PCB HAS BEEN FULLY ASSEMBLED, IT MUST BE MOUNTED TO AN ADEQUATE HEAT SINK BEFORE THE BIAS ADJUSTMENT CAN BE PERFORMED. A HEAT SINK WITH A MAXIMUM THERMAL RESISTANCE OF 1.5 DEGREE CENTIGRADE/WATT IS RECOMMENDED FOR CONVECTION. Place the completed PCB on the heat sink. Use masking tape or equivalent to hold the PCB still during the marking process. Using a transfer punch, carefully mark the center of the four PCB mounting holes that contain the spacers, the two RF transistor mounting holes, and the two mounting tab holes at the edge of the PCB. Communication Concepts Heatsink USA A transfer punch is a punch of a specific outer diameter that is non-tapered and extends the entire length of the punch (except for the tip). It is used to tightly fit the tolerances of an existing hole and, when struck, precisely transfer the center of that hole to another surface. Page 39 of 46

42 Bias Adjustment The SkyWave DX150 amplifier has been designed to operate with class-ab biasing. IMPORTANT TO KEEP OUTPUT HARMONICS AT SPECIFIED LEVELS, THE BIAS MUST BE ADJUSTED PRIOR TO THE AMPLIFIER BEING PUT INTO SERVICE. Solder the two wires from SW1 (ON/OFF) together. Solder the two wires from SW2 (SSB DELAY) together. Insert 15A fuse (F1). Place an ammeter across jumper (JMP1) terminals. Turn VR1 (BIAS) fully counter-clockwise. Connect the 13.8VDC power cord to a power supply. Connect RF IN (center conductor of coaxial cable) to 13.8VDC. Ground of coaxial cable remains disconnected. Turn power supply on and set output at 13.8VDC. Adjust VR1 (BIAS) slowly clockwise to obtain 200mA (+/-25mA) on the ammeter. Disconnect all connections to power supply and ammeter. IMPORTANT - THE TWO PADS ON THE JUMPER MUST BE SHORTED TOGETHER FOR THE AMPLIFIER TO OPERATE PROPERLY. Apply a liberal amount of solder to the jumper (JMP1) pads so a solder bridge is formed. 43 Amplifier Operation Connecting the Amplifier IMPORTANT - THE AMPLIFIER REQUIRES A DC POWER SOURCE CAPABLE OF 13.8V@15A TO ACHIEVE MAXIMUM POWER OUTPUT. IN THE FINAL APPLICATION, KEEP THE POWER CABLE AS SHORT AS POSSIBLE TO OPTIMIZE AMPLIFIER PERFORMANCE. Attach the power cable to a DC source. IMPORTANT - MAKE CERTAIN THAT THE ANTENNA/FEEDLINE SWR IS 1.5:1 OR LOWER. A HIGH SWR WILL CAUSE EXCESSIVE OUTPUT TRANSISTOR HEATING THAT COULD RESULT IN PREMATURE DEVICE FAILURE. Hook the amplifier RF IN via a 50-Ohm coaxial cable to the driving transmitter. Hook the amplifier RF OUT via a 50-Ohm coaxial cable to the transmitting antenna. Install a SPST switch to the wiring coming from SW1 (POWER). Install a SPST switch to the wiring coming from SW2 (SSB). Install an LED to the wiring coming from LED1 (POWER). Install an LED to the wiring coming from LED2 (XMIT). Transmitting Set SW1 (POWER) switch to the ON position. Set SW2 (SSB) switch to the ON position if transmitter is in SSB mode. The amplifier is now ready for operation. Page 43 of 46

44 Troubleshooting Problem Possible Cause Possible Solution Amplifier doesn t operate (Power switch ON but power indicator not lit) Power source not connected. Fuse missing or blown. Check F1. Faulty wiring from SW1 switch to circuit board. Check connection to power source. Check wiring from SW1 switch to circuit board. Amplifier doesn t operate (Power switch on and power indicator lit) Insufficient or no RF drive. Check transmitter and coaxial cable to input of amplifier. Relay engages on transmit but amplifier has no output power. J1 open. Check that J1 is shorted. Relay chatters during SSB operation. SW2 switch not in SSB position. Faulty wiring from SW2 switch to circuit board. Move SW2 switch to proper position. Check wiring from SW2 switch to circuit board. Relay chatters during AM/FM operation. Insufficient drive power. Increase drive power. Amplifier keeps blowing fuse. Plastic insulating washers (WASHER1, WASHER2, WASHER3) improperly installed. Insulators (INSUL1, INSUL2, INSUL3) improperly installed. Check plastic insulating washers on Q1, Q4, Q5. Check insulators on Q1, Q4, Q5. Page 44 of 46

45 Specifications Parameter Conditions/Notes Value Operating Modes - AM, FM, SSB Voltage Requirements Typical Maximum +13.8VDC +16VDC DC Current Maximum 12A RF Input Power RF Power Output Minimum Compression 500mW (AM, FM) 10W-RMS (AM, FM) 40W-PEP (SSB) 70W-RMS (AM/FM) 130W-PEP (SSB) 2nd Harmonic 25W CW@28MHz Typical -46dBc *** 3rd Harmonic 25W CW@28MHz Typical -30dBc Input / Output Impedance Typical 50-Ohms Input SWR Typical 1.2:1 Power Gain 8dB Bandwidth 26-30MHz 0.5dB Gain Flatness Class-AB Bias Current +25 C Heat Sink Temperature 200mA +/-25mA Fuse ATO - Automotive Type 15A SSB Relay Dropout Delay Typical 1.0 Second Stand-By Power Typical 75mW Reverse Voltage Protection No Damage to Amplifier or Fuse Continuous Thermal Shutdown Heat Sink Temperature ~120 C PCB Solder Mask & Silkscreen Premium FR4 Material *** Decibels below carrier. An antenna system with an SWR of 1.5:1 or less is critical for proper amplifier operation. Standing Wave Ratio. Page 45 of 46
